Understanding the Conversion Basics
To start off, let's talk about the basics of fluid measurement. The US customary system uses a combination of cups, pints, quarts, and gallons to measure liquids. Here's a brief rundown of the conversion hierarchy:- 1 gallon = 4 quarts
- 1 quart = 2 pints
- 1 pint = 2 cups
- 1 cup = 8 ounces
So, if we want to convert 48 ounces to gallons, we'll need to work our way up the hierarchy.
Converting Ounces to Gallons: A Step-by-Step Guide
To convert 48 ounces to gallons, follow these steps:- First, divide 48 by 128 (since 1 gallon = 128 ounces). This gives us: 48 ÷ 128 = 0.375
- Now, multiply 0.375 by 1 gallon to get the final result: 0.375 × 1 gallon = 0.375 gallons

Understanding the Basics of Liquid Measurement
Before we proceed, it's essential to grasp the fundamental units of measurement for liquids. In the United States, the most commonly used units are ounces, cups, pints, quarts, and gallons. Each unit represents a specific volume of liquid: * 1 ounce (oz) = 1/128 US gallon * 1 cup = 8 fluid ounces * 1 pint (pt) = 2 cups or 16 fluid ounces * 1 quart (qt) = 4 cups or 32 fluid ounces * 1 gallon (gal) = 4 quarts or 128 fluid ounces With this foundation in place, we can now tackle the question of how many gallons are equivalent to 48 ounces.Converting Ounces to Gallons: A Mathematical Approach
To convert 48 ounces to gallons, we can use the following mathematical formula: gal = oz / 128 where gal represents the number of gallons, and oz represents the number of ounces. Plugging in the value of 48 ounces, we get: gal = 48 / 128 ≈ 0.375 Therefore, 48 ounces is equivalent to approximately 0.375 gallons.
